Dora Observation
Platform
Location - Jeomwon-ri, Gunnae-myeon, Paju-si |
|
|
| |
>
Introduction
It was founded to exchange as OP in Songaksan is
closed. It is the northernmost observatory of South
Korea from which visitors can view a part of North
Korean life through a telescope, such as Mt. Songaksan
in Gaeseong, Kim Il-seong statue, Gijeong-dong,
the outskirts of Gaeseong-si, Train smokestack at
Jangdan station, and Geumamgol (collective farm).
This has 304 sq. ft. and some facilities; 500 capacity,
VIP Room, control office, 30 to 40 capacity parking
lot. It has opened to the public since Jan. 1987.

Transportation |
Public Transportation |
1. Train: get off Imjin River station of
the Gyeongui line and take bus No. 94 at Munsan
Terminal abound for Imjingak
2. Bus: take No.909 at Bulgwang-dong or No.922
at Gwanghwamun, take bus No. 94 at Munsan
Terminal abound for Imjingak |
| |
Car |
1. Seoul ~ Tongilro~ Byeokje ~ Munsan ~
Imjingak by a tourist bus ~ Tongil Bridge
~ Tongilchon ~ The 3rd Tunne
l2. Gimpo Airport ~ Haengju Bridge ~ Jayuro
~ Munsan ~ Imjingak by a tourist bus ~ Tongil
Bridge ~ Tongilchon ~ The 3rd Tunnel
¡Ø A private car is prohibited to enter Tongil
Bridge except a tourist bus |
